Understanding the Need for Professional Dead Rat Removal

The reasons for seeking professional dead rat removal in Palo Alto are multifaceted. Firstly, the most immediate concern is the odor. As a rodent carcass decomposes, it releases volatile organic compounds that create a powerful and persistent smell, often permeating through walls and ventilation systems. This odor can be particularly challenging to eliminate without professional intervention. Secondly, dead rats can attract other scavengers and insects, potentially exacerbating pest problems. Lastly, and most importantly, decomposing rodents can harbor and spread pathogens, posing a health hazard to occupants.

How Local Experts Handle Dead Rat Removal

When you connect with a local exterminator through Rat Damage Pest Control, you’re engaging a professional equipped to handle the situation with expertise and care. The process typically involves several key steps, tailored to the specific location of the deceased rodent. Whether it’s within walls, attics, crawl spaces, or other hard-to-reach areas, these professionals have the tools and knowledge to access and safely remove the carcass. They are trained to wear app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) to prevent exposure to potential contaminants. Following removal, thorough sanitation and disinfection of the affected area are crucial to neutralize any lingering pathogens and eliminate odors, often using specialized enzymatic cleaners and disinfectants.

Commonly Used Methods and Materials

Local pest control professionals utilize a range of methods and materials designed for effective and safe dead rodent disposal. This can include:

  • Specialized tools for reaching into tight spaces, such as long-handled grabbers and inspection cameras.
  • Heavy-duty containment bags to prevent leakage and spread of contaminants.
  • Industrial-grade disinfectants and deodorizers to thoroughly sanitize and neutralize odors in the affected areas.
  • In some cases, materials for sealing entry points to prevent future rodent infestations may be recommended.

Frequently Asked Questions About Dead Rat Removal in Palo Alto

What are the health risks associated with a dead rat?

Decomposing rodents can carry and spread various pathogens, including bacteria and viruses, which can cause illnesses in humans and pets if handled improperly or if their presence leads to contaminated food or water sources. Professional removal and sanitization are essential for mitigating these risks.

How quickly can a dead rat odor be eliminated in a Palo Alto home?

The time it takes to eliminate the odor depends on the size and location of the carcass, as well as the effectiveness of the sanitization process. Professional technicians utilize specialized deodorizing agents and ventilation techniques that can significantly speed up the odor removal process, often achieving substantial improvement within 24-48 hours after removal and treatment.

Are there specific areas in Palo Alto where dead rat issues are more common?

Properties in Palo Alto with proximity to natural areas, such as those near the foothills or along water corridors, may experience more frequent rodent activity. Older homes with less robust sealing, or properties with extensive landscaping that offers cover and food sources, can also be more susceptible. However, a deceased rodent can appear in any home or business, regardless of its specific location within the city, emphasizing the importance of having reliable removal services available throughout Palo Alto.

What rats destroy in Palo Alto homes

Left unchecked, rats cause real, costly damage in Palo Alto homes: they gnaw constantly to wear down their teeth, and chewed electrical wiring is a leading, under-recognized cause of house fires. They shred insulation and stored belongings for nesting, gnaw through drywall, pipes, and even softer structural wood, and foul attics, wall voids, and pantries with urine and droppings that soak into insulation and subfloor. What starts as a few droppings can end in rewiring and insulation replacement — which is why removal and permanent exclusion beat one-off trapping.

Palo Alto rodent warning signs

Telltale signs of rats in Palo Alto homes: fresh droppings along baseboards and near food, gnaw marks on wood, wiring, and packaging, dark grease rub-marks where they travel walls, scratching or scurrying inside walls and ceilings at night, shredded-paper or insulation nests, and a lingering musky ammonia smell. You will often hear or smell them before you see one.

How Dead Rat Removal works in Palo Alto

Dead rodent removal starts by pinpointing the source of the odor — often inside a wall, under a floor, or in ductwork — then safely removing the carcass, cleaning and disinfecting the area, and treating for the flies and odor that follow. A thorough job also finds how the animal got in, so the next one does not repeat it.

Why rodents are a health hazard in Palo Alto

The health stakes are real: rats spread hantavirus, salmonella, and leptospirosis through droppings and urine, their waste triggers asthma and allergies, and they carry fleas and ticks indoors. Cleanup of heavily soiled areas should be done with proper protection, not a household vacuum that can aerosolize contaminants.

Is my Palo Alto landlord responsible for rodents?

Structural gaps — foundation cracks, unscreened vents, worn door sweeps — are building-maintenance issues, so California habitability law almost always makes the landlord responsible for sealing entry points and arranging removal when the tenant did not cause the problem. Put every notice in writing.
